Decompressive aspiration in myelinoclastic diffuse sclerosis or Schilder disease. Case report

Summary
Rapidly progressive cerebral demyelinating disease in a child caused hemiplegia and intracranial hypertension. Surgical aspiration of brain lesions led to complete recovery, highlighting a novel treatment approach.

Background:
- Cerebral demyelinating diseases can present with severe neurological deficits in children.
- Intracranial hypertension and mass effect are critical complications requiring prompt management.
Observation:
- A 9-year-old girl presented with hemiplegia and signs of increased intracranial pressure.
- Brain imaging identified multiple subcortical white matter lesions with significant mass effect.
Findings:
- Pathological examination confirmed demyelination within the observed lesions.
- Initial corticosteroid treatment provided partial recovery.
- Decompressive aspiration of the largest lesion resulted in complete neurological improvement.
Implications:
- Surgical intervention, specifically decompressive aspiration, can be a highly effective treatment for severe pediatric cerebral demyelinating disease with mass effect.
- This case suggests a potential therapeutic role for surgical decompression in select pediatric demyelinating conditions.
- Further research into surgical outcomes for pediatric demyelinating diseases is warranted.
